Sweden vs Poland pole vault clash set for Torun

Some of the best pole vaulters in Europe have been confirmed for the Orlen Copernicus Cup in Torun on 8 February, the fourth stop on the 2020 World Athletics Indoor Tour.

In what looks set to be a Sweden vs Poland battle, world silver medallist and European champion Armand Duplantis will line up alongside fellow Swede Melker Svard Jacobsson, the European indoor bronze medallist, as they take on Poland’s world bronze medallist Piotr Lisek and 2011 world champion Paweł Wojciechowski.

While Lisek and Wojciechowski have competed in Torun in front of their home crowd on numerous occasions, Swedish duo Duplantis and Jacobsson will be competing there for the first time.

“I’m really happy that the men’s pole vault will be one of the best events of the meeting,” said general director Krzysztof Wolsztynski. “We’re currently preparing the fields for our track events, but the pole vault and women’s long jump will bring so much joy to the supporters at Arena Torun. Duplantis and Lisek have topped six metres, but I believe that our local hero Pawel Wojciechowski will join the ‘six-metre club’ after the Orlen Copernicus Cup.”
